After a refreshing break in the wilds of Scotland the Polyhedron Collider crew get back together to discuss the board games they have been playing. We talk about Scythe yet again (well it is popular) and we take an in depth look at Fluxx, Multiuniversum, Vampire Hunters and Eldritch Horror.
We also give a shout out to the Brawling Brothers for supporting our show, and an argument about a brewery start some impromptu Sean Bean impressions.

Steve is our only hope as his misfit rebellion defeat Andy’s evil empire in Star Wars Rebellion, Andy takes his revenge as a blood hungry vampire in Fury of Dracula and John talks about Imps Devilish Duels, a game of dice and cards from Triple Ace Games. The boys also take another look at the economic worker placement games of Crisis and Scythe. Discussion is then prompted by questions from listeners where all three weigh in with their thoughts on Battleships, Legacy games and the Spiel des Jahres nominees.

Welcome to the Polyhedron Collider Interview Cast. These interviews where recorded on the show floor at Salute 2016. First we speak to Paranoid Miniatures about their Lovecraft inspired miniatures game Mythos. We then speak to Jack Caesar from River Horse about The Hunt for Red October board game and finally from Alessio Cavatore about the upcoming Labyrinth board game and the My Little Pony RPG.

Jesse Bergman and John Kimmel join me over Skype a chat about their Kickstarted customisable card game Battle for Sularia, where they talk about their history in gaming, the development process for the game and future plans.
